    Germany Refurbished Electronics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the Germany refurbished electronics market size was estimated at 7.79 USD Billion in 2024. The Germany refurbished electronics market is projected to grow from 8.82 USD Billion in 2025 to 30.42 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 13.18%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    Cost-Effectiveness of Refurbished Products

    The economic advantages associated with purchasing refurbished electronics are likely to drive market growth in Germany. Consumers are increasingly looking for cost-effective solutions, especially in a fluctuating economy. Refurbished products typically offer substantial savings, often ranging from 20% to 50% compared to new items. This price differential makes refurbished electronics an attractive option for budget-conscious consumers. In 2025, the refurbished electronics market is projected to grow by approximately 15% in Germany, driven by this cost-effectiveness. Additionally, businesses and educational institutions are also turning to refurbished devices to manage their budgets more efficiently. This trend indicates that the cost-effectiveness of refurbished products is a crucial driver in the industry, appealing to a wide range of consumers.

    Key Players and Competitive Insights

    The refurbished electronics market in Germany exhibits a dynamic competitive landscape, characterized by a blend of established global players and emerging local firms. Key growth drivers include increasing consumer awareness regarding sustainability, rising demand for cost-effective alternatives to new devices, and advancements in refurbishment technologies. Major companies such as Apple (US), Samsung (KR), and Dell (US) are strategically positioned to leverage their brand equity and technological expertise. Apple (US) focuses on enhancing its refurbishment processes to ensure high-quality standards, while Samsung (KR) emphasizes innovation in its product offerings. Dell (US) is actively pursuing partnerships with local refurbishers to expand its market reach, thereby shaping a competitive environment that is increasingly reliant on quality and service differentiation.

    The business tactics employed by these companies reflect a concerted effort to optimize supply chains and localize manufacturing. The market structure appears moderately fragmented, with a mix of large corporations and smaller players vying for market share. This fragmentation allows for diverse consumer choices, yet the collective influence of key players like Lenovo (CN) and HP (US) is significant, as they drive industry standards and consumer expectations through their operational strategies.

    In October 2025, Lenovo (CN) announced a new initiative aimed at enhancing its refurbishment capabilities by investing in advanced testing technologies. This strategic move is likely to bolster Lenovo's reputation for quality and reliability in the refurbished segment, potentially attracting a broader customer base that prioritizes performance alongside cost savings. Such investments may also streamline operations, reducing turnaround times for refurbished products.

    In September 2025, HP (US) launched a comprehensive sustainability program that includes a commitment to increasing the percentage of refurbished products in its portfolio. This initiative not only aligns with global sustainability trends but also positions HP (US) as a leader in responsible electronics consumption. By promoting refurbished devices, HP (US) aims to capture environmentally conscious consumers, thereby enhancing its market presence and brand loyalty.

    In August 2025, Samsung (KR) unveiled a partnership with local refurbishers to create a certified refurbishment program. This collaboration is expected to enhance the quality assurance of refurbished products, thereby instilling greater consumer confidence. By ensuring that refurbished devices meet stringent quality standards, Samsung (KR) is likely to differentiate itself in a crowded market, appealing to consumers who may be hesitant about purchasing refurbished electronics.

    Industry Developments

    The Germany Refurbished Electronics Market has recently seen substantial developments, reflecting a growing consumer interest in sustainable electronics. Companies such as Back Market, Rebuy, and Asgoodasnew are spearheading innovations, emphasizing quality guarantees and eco-friendliness. In October 2023, Mister Gadget announced a partnership with local tech schools to promote refurbished devices among students, enhancing their brand engagement. 

    Meanwhile, Ingram Micro has expanded its logistics network, improving the turnaround time for refurbished products across Germany. Sellpy and eBay Refurbished continue to see increased sales as consumers adopt eco-conscious buying practices. Notably, there have been no significant mergers or acquisitions among the key players like Flipsy and Amazon Renewed in recent months, but market observers are keen on potential future collaborations. 

    The market's valuation is on an upward trend, partly due to legislative support for sustainability initiatives in Germany, prompting a robust growth environment for refurbished electronics. Over the last two years, a marked shift toward refurbished electronics has emerged as companies adapt to changing consumer preferences, indicating a long-term impact on the electronics landscape in Germany.
